Renters should consider single rooms as 'affordable' option, Statistics Canada says

Federal agency finds Vancouver's apartment lease rates highest in Canada as Montreal's rise quickly
Montreal remains Canada's 17th most expensive city to rent an apartment but it leads all metropolitan areas in price appreciation since 2019. (Olivier Gariépy/CoStar)

Renters might want to consider single rooms if the housing market remains too expensive, according to Statistics Canada.
